Casual atmosphere, great pizza.. Perhaps the least 'hip' of the (relatively) newer pizzarias, Tomatohead dances to the beat of it's own drummer: Unlike any New York, DOC, or other Chicago pizza, Tomatohead has a different crust, a very good, crispy thin crust.(I've never asked what it's made of...semolina?) Service is matter-off-fact, as it's obviously a 95% delivery & carry-out, 'old-school' neighborhood-style joint, except that the pizza's better.

Editorial Review. Known for its thin-crust pies, this restaurant also serves pasta, hot and cold sandwiches and salads.
